Connect Heap and Xero with AI

Sync product usage data with financial records to understand which customer behaviors drive revenue. Stop manually exporting interaction data to match against invoices, subscriptions, and customer lifetime value.

No code required
Live in minutes
SOC 2 Type II

What you can automate today

Redbird gives your team ready-to-run workflows — just connect your accounts and go.

Sync trial user activity to Xero customer records for conversion analysis

Automatically enrich Xero contact records with Heap behavioral data showing product engagement during trial periods. Surface which features correlate with paid conversions and identify high-intent prospects based on usage patterns before they subscribe.

Track revenue by feature adoption and product engagement cohorts

Combine Heap's behavioral segments with Xero's invoice and payment data to calculate revenue per user cohort. Understand which product flows and feature sets generate the highest customer lifetime value and inform product roadmap decisions with financial outcomes.

Alert finance team when high-usage customers show payment issues

Monitor Xero for overdue invoices or failed payments from customers Heap identifies as power users. Trigger proactive outreach to retain valuable accounts before churn, prioritizing customers with strong product engagement and subscription history.

Generate customer health scores combining product usage and payment behavior

Merge Heap interaction frequency, feature adoption, and session depth with Xero payment timeliness and subscription tenure. Create composite health metrics that reflect both product engagement and financial relationship strength for customer success teams.

Link subscription plan changes to pre-upgrade product behavior patterns

When customers upgrade or downgrade plans in Xero, automatically pull their Heap behavioral data from the preceding 30 days. Identify which product interactions predict plan changes and optimize upgrade prompts based on usage signals.

Build monthly revenue reports segmented by user journey and conversion path

Combine Heap's funnel and journey data with Xero revenue by customer to understand which acquisition paths and onboarding flows generate the most profitable customers. Automatically generate executive reports showing revenue attribution by product experience.

Live in four steps

No engineers, no pipelines to maintain. Redbird handles the connectivity — you focus on the outcome.

01

Connect your accounts

Authorize Heap and Xero with OAuth or API credentials. Redbird never stores your data — it just passes through.

02

Describe what you want

Tell Redbird what to do in plain language — no SQL, no code, no configuration files required.

03

Review and activate

Redbird shows you exactly what it will do before running anything. Approve the workflow, set a schedule, and switch it on.

04

Let it run — and iterate

Workflows run on your schedule or on triggers. Every run is logged. Adjust with natural language at any time.

Built for data-driven teams

Redbird understands Heap's event schemas and interaction metadata alongside Xero's financial objects, automatically mapping user behaviors to customer accounts, invoices, and payment history.

AI that speaks both product analytics and accounting

Redbird's AI natively parses Heap's autocaptured event streams, user properties, and behavioral segments while understanding Xero's contact records, invoice line items, payment statuses, and subscription structures. It automatically matches customer identifiers across systems, handles behavioral aggregations for financial periods, and resolves discrepancies between product user IDs and billing contacts. The platform interprets complex queries like 'show revenue from customers who completed onboarding within 7 days' without custom code or manual joins.

Event-to-invoice mapping
Behavioral cohort revenue
Customer ID reconciliation
Usage-based billing sync
10×

faster than exporting Heap CSVs and matching to Xero reports in spreadsheets

No manual event exports, customer matching in Google Sheets, or pivot tables to calculate revenue by behavior segment

Auto-generated reports

Redbird can pull from Heap and Xero simultaneously, merge the results, and format a polished report — sent on a schedule or on demand.

Trigger-based alerts

Set conditions in natural language. Get notified in Slack or email the moment a threshold is crossed in either Heap or Xero.

Enterprise-grade security

SOC 2 Type II certified. Data flows encrypted in transit and at rest. Fine-grained permission controls with full audit logs.

Bidirectional sync

Push data from Heap into Xero, or from Xero back into Heap. Resolve conflicts with configurable merge rules.

Full audit trail

Every workflow run is logged — what ran, what changed, and why. Replay or revert any individual step at any time.

Triggers & actions for every team

Start automations from any user interaction in Heap or financial event in Xero, then take action across your entire stack.

Heap
Triggers & Actions
Trigger

User completes conversion funnel

Fires when a user successfully progresses through a defined funnel sequence in Heap.

Trigger

Segment membership changes

Triggers when a user enters or exits a behavioral segment based on interaction patterns.

Trigger

Session duration threshold exceeded

Activates when a user session surpasses a specified time threshold indicating deep engagement.

Action

Query user event history

Retrieve complete interaction history for a specific user across a defined time period.

Action

Pull conversion metrics by cohort

Extract funnel completion rates and drop-off points for specific user segments.

Action

Export behavioral properties

Extract custom user properties derived from interaction patterns and feature usage.

Xero
Triggers & Actions
Trigger

Invoice payment received

Fires when a payment is recorded against an invoice in Xero, updating account balance.

Trigger

Invoice becomes overdue

Triggers when an invoice passes its due date without full payment being received.

Trigger

New contact created

Activates when a new customer or supplier contact is added to the Xero organization.

Action

Update contact custom fields

Modify custom field values on Xero contact records with external data like usage metrics.

Action

Retrieve invoice history

Pull complete invoicing and payment history for a specific contact across all time periods.

Action

Generate financial report extract

Export profit and loss, balance sheet, or custom report data for specific date ranges.

Heap
+
Xero

Ready to connect your stack?

Link product behavior to revenue outcomes by connecting Heap and Xero. Understand which user interactions drive subscription growth and customer value without manual data exports.

Get started → Book a demo